Hieromonk Bartholomew reveals the spiritual life of singer Giorgos Mazonakis
In mid-September 2026, public revelations emerged regarding the private life of popular Greek singer Giorgos Mazonakis. Hieromonk Bartholomew, associated with the Patriarchal Exarchate of Patmos and the Holy Monastery of Saint John the Theologian, spoke during the show 'Reportaz Tora' to journalist Andreas Karagiannis about his personal connection with the artist.
The acquaintance between the two began in 2016 during the singer's summer visits to the island of Patmos. According to the monk, Mazonakis frequently visited the Holy Cave of the Apocalypse and the Monastery of Saint John the Theologian. During these visits, the singer sought to set aside his public persona and celebrity status to engage in spiritual discourse with the monks, demonstrating a deep faith in the Orthodox Church that contrasted with his professional image as a provocative entertainer.
These testimonials provide insight into a previously unknown dimension of the singer's personality, highlighting his private religious devotion during his travels.
